Start the Find utility in Windows by holding the Windows key and then
pressing F. Type the file name (normal.dotm) in the "All or part of the
file name" box. Click More advanced options, and make sure that "Search
system folders," "Search hidden files and folders," and "Search subfolders"
are all checked. Then click the Search button.

Exit Word and then rename the normal.dotm file. You can perform a search
in
Windows for the file (be sure to search hidden files and folders). When
you
restart Word, a clean copy of Normal with factory default settings will
be
created.
